Book Overview

New from the Author of the Best-Selling Elm Creek Quilts Novels

The staff of the fictional Elm Creek quilter's retreat-and 72 of author Jennifer Chiaverini's real-life friends-contributed 140 blocks to this beautiful sampler quilt that became Sylvia Compson's wedding gift in The Master Quilter. Now you can join quilters around the world in making this much-loved quilt. Sylvia's Bridal Sampler makes a wonderful wedding gift, guild project, or raffle quilt.

- Celebrate the enduring bonds of friendship and create your own authentic version of the "secret" bridal sampler from The Master Quilter
- Get together with other quilters to mix, match, and share 140 traditional blocks
- Enjoy the gallery of sampler quilts made by other Elm Creek readers
- Book includes complete instructions and full-sized patterns for every block from the sampler

About Jennifer Chiaverini

Jennifer Chiaverini is a graduate of the University of Notre Dame and the University of Chicago. She is the author of many books, most recently Mrs. Lincoln's Dressmaker. She lives with her husband and sons in Madison, Wisconsin.
